Praise has poured in for three crew members who sacrificed their lives trying to help passengers to safety while the Sewol ferry sunk last Wednesday off the coast of South Korea. Park Ji-young, a 22-year-old part-time ferry employee, reportedly helped passengers escape and tended to the injured. Survivors said that she refused to leave the ship while there were still passengers to be rescued. “She was so responsible and so kind,” Park’s grandmother Choi Sun Dok told CNN at a funeral home in the city of Incheon, near the capital Seoul.
